关于日本铁道机车车辆与其周边界面关系几个问题的研究 被引量:2
1
作者 俞展猷 《铁道机车车辆》 2004年第2期9-12,60,共5页
铁道机车车辆与其周边界面关系的几个问题 ,包括轮轨关系、弓网关系、空气动力学 (气动力学 )、轨道电路和噪声等。在轮轨关系中分析了车轮与钢轨间的粘着特性和润滑以及如何减少车轮轮缘与钢轨内侧轨角的磨耗。在弓网关系中分析了如何... 铁道机车车辆与其周边界面关系的几个问题 ,包括轮轨关系、弓网关系、空气动力学 (气动力学 )、轨道电路和噪声等。在轮轨关系中分析了车轮与钢轨间的粘着特性和润滑以及如何减少车轮轮缘与钢轨内侧轨角的磨耗。在弓网关系中分析了如何保持接触网和受电弓的良好接触状态即如何使接触网和受电弓的接触力变化小以及引起接触力变化的原因和减少这种变化的措施。在气动力学的影响中分析了列车在隧道中运行时 ,车辆振动增大的原因和减少振动的措施。在轨道电路中分析了如何减少轮轨接触电阻。 展开更多

关于日本铁道机车车辆与其周边界面关系几个问题的研究(2)

The paper studies on relations between railway rolling stock and peripheral interfaces in Japanese railways.It covers the relations between wheel and rail,the relations between pantograph and catenary,the air dynamics,track circuit and noise,etc.In the study on relations between wheel and rail,the adhesive property between wheel and rail,the lubrication of wheel and rail and wear reduction between wteel flange and inner rail corner were analyzed.In the study on relations between pantograph and catenary,the author focused on the contact status between the pantograph and catenary,e.g.,how to minimize the variation of the contact force,causes of the variation and the protection measures.In dynamics study,Increase of rolling stock shock in tunnels and shock absorption measures are analyzed.In track circuit study,reduction of wheel/rail contact resistance is analyzed.In noise study,causes of rolling noise and structural noise as well as the numerical value module are analyzed. 展开更多
